Indy Chamber

Non-profit OrganizationsIndiana, United States51-200 Employees

Indy Chamber is a mid-sized nonprofit organization based in Indianapolis, central Indiana. It aims to make the Indianapolis region the best place to live and do business, pursuing this through several program areas, including Entrepreneur Services, Economic Development, and Business Advocacy. The organization focuses on attracting businesses to the area, supporting entrepreneurs and startups, and advocating for fair business policies to strengthen the regional economy. Through these efforts, it serves as a hub for economic development and business support in the region.

In May 2026, the Indy Chamber partnered with Mirror Indy to launch the IN Focus Award to elevate local businesses.
